Painting Description
"A Beauty In Medieval Costume" is a notable painting by the American artist Sydney Richmond Burleigh, created in the late 19th or early 20th century. Burleigh, born in 1853 and active until his death in 1931, was a prominent figure in the American art scene, particularly known for his contributions to the Arts and Crafts movement. His works often reflect a deep appreciation for historical themes and meticulous attention to detail, characteristics that are vividly evident in "A Beauty In Medieval Costume."
